Vitera Introducing Enhanced Tools at MGMA 2013

Enhanced Tools to Prepare Practices for Regulatory Changes Ahead

TAMPA, FL – Vitera Healthcare Solutions, the nation’s premier provider of ambulatory electronic health records (EHR) and practice management (PM) software and services, announced it will introduce enhanced solutions and services at MGMA 2013 to help physicians prepare their practices for industry and regulatory changes ahead.

Vitera is a premier sponsor of the Medical Group Management Association’s annual conference, one of the largest professional development and healthcare management conferences in the country, being held Oct. 6-9 in San Diego.

The company will preview its Vitera Intergy v9.00, an industry-leading EHR solution that is Meaningful Use 2014 Edition-certified, ICD–10-ready and enhanced with an intuitive, customizable way to help physician’s document patient encounters.

Independent researcher Black Book Market Research rated Vitera No. 1 in its 2013 EHR user satisfaction survey, and Vitera recently won the Frost & Sullivan 2013 Customer Value Enhancement Award for outstanding customer service and customer return on investment.

Other demonstrations at MGMA include: Vitera Stat, a cloud-based, all-in-one PM and EHR solution; Vitera Clinical Exchange, which connects practices to hospitals, state immunization registries and HIEs; and Vitera Practice Analytics, which provides financial and clinical role-based dashboards that report on patient risk levels and core coordination programs.

Much of healthcare reform, including emerging incentive-based payment models such as the Patient-Centered Medical Home, will rely on leading technologies like Vitera Intergy to help transition the industry from a volume-based system to a quality-based system.

Vitera Intergy v.900 was recently approved for 2011 PCMH prevalidation by the National Committee for Quality Assurance (NCQA), the most popular Patient Centered Medical Home program. It is one of only three ambulatory EHR solutions to earn this designation.
